reactnative keyboardawarescrollview 用法 react-native-keyboard-aware-scroll-view是一个可以自动适应键盘高度的组件,其用法如下: 1. 安装:使用 npm或者yarn安装react-native-keyboard-aware-scroll-view包。 2. 引入:在代码中引入组件,使用`import KeyboardAwareScrollView from 'react-native-keyboard-aware-scroll-...
在node_modules/@react-native-oh-tpl/react-native-keyboard-aware-scroll-view/lib/KeyboardAwareHOC.j...
我一直在玩它一段时间,但没有运气。我正在运行 react-native v 0.33 和 react-native-keyboard-aware-scroll-view v 0.2.1。 https://www.npmjs.com/package/react-native-keyboard-aware-scroll-view import { KeyboardAwareScrollView } from 'react-native-keyboard-aware-scroll-view'; class LoginIOS extend...
操作系统将为你解决大部分的问题,KeyboardAvoidingView 会为你解决剩下的问题。参见 这个。接下的部分可能不适用于你。 Keyboard Aware ScrollView 下一种解决办法是使用react-native-keyboard-aware-scroll-view,他会给你很大的冲击。实际上它使用了ScrollView和ListView处理所有的事情(取决于你选择的组件),让滑动交互变...
通过react-native-keyboard-aware-scroll-view 解决键盘遮盖输入框的问题,1.安装2.引入3.调用4.常用方法(1)跳到自定输入框(2)监听键盘显示或隐藏 onKeyboardWillShow 和 onKeyboardWillHide:5.效果图
npm i react-native-keyboard-aware-scroll-view --saveyarn add react-native-keyboard-aware-scroll-viewUsageYou can use the KeyboardAwareScrollView, KeyboardAwareSectionList or the KeyboardAwareFlatList components. They accept ScrollView, SectionList and FlatList default props respectively and implement a ...
可以采用React Native提供的KeyboardAvoidingView组件,该组件可以自动将视图向上移动,以避开键盘。在需要避开键盘的部分包裹该组件,并设置behavior属性为"padding"或者"position",具体效果可以根据实际情况调整。 使用第三方库:可以使用React Native提供的第三方库,例如react-native-keyboard-aware-scroll-view,该库可以...
react-native-keyboard-aware-scroll-view 适用于 scrollView、ListView、FlatList、SectionList 上有输入框的问题 解决键盘挡住输入框问题 点击按钮让scrollView滚动到指定位置 Installation npm i react-native-keyboard-aware-scroll-view --save Usage import { KeyboardAwareScrollView } from 'react-native-keyboard-...
react-native-keyboard-aware-scroll-view 下一种解决办法是使用react-native-keyboard-aware-scroll-view,他会给你很大的冲击。实际上它使用了ScrollView和ListView处理所有的事情(取决于你选择的组件),让滑动交互变得更加自然。它另外一个优点是它会自动将屏幕滚动到获得焦点的输入框处,这会带来非常流畅的用户体验。
<KeyboardAwareScrollView> <View> <TextInput /> </View> </KeyboardAwareScrollView> 4.常用方法 (1)跳到自定输入框 1 2 3 4 5 6 7 8 9 10 11 12 13 _scrollToInput (reactNode: any) { // Add a 'scroll' ref to your ScrollView